11. Budget-Friendly Tips for Beginners

Starting out in LARP doesn’t have to be expensive. You can create an impressive look without spending a fortune.

Tips for Affordable LARP Costuming:

  1. Start with neutral basics: tunics, belts, boots.

  2. Use thrifted or second-hand pieces as a base.

  3. Add accessories like belts, pouches, and necklaces.

  4. Focus on durability over decoration.

  5. DIY props like staffs or daggers using foam or wood.

Affordable LARP costumes can still look professional with creativity and effort.

12. Common Mistakes to Avoid

Even the best LARPers slip up when costuming. Avoid these common pitfalls:

  • Mixing modern clothing with fantasy outfits.

  • Ignoring the event’s theme or time period.

  • Using shiny synthetics that look fake.

  • Wearing uncomfortable boots or armor.

  • Skipping layers needed for weather protection.

Attention to these details ensures your fantasy LARP outfit enhances immersion instead of breaking it.

15. The Psychology Behind Dressing the Part

Dressing up affects how you think and act. When you wear your live action role-play costume, you experience a mental shift known as enclothed cognition — your brain adopts the traits associated with your outfit.

Armor makes you feel braver. Robes make you feel wiser. A hood makes you feel stealthier. Costumes help you believe in the role you’re portraying.

That belief leads to deeper, more satisfying fantasy role-playing experiences.
